Efficient extraction of singlet-triplet excitons for high-efficient white organic light-emitting diode with a multilayer emission region

摘要

We reported a highly efficient white organic light-emitting diode (WOLED) with a multilayer emission region made of sequentially evaporated host and guest layers. The singlet and triplet excitons were harvested in two separate channels. An external quantum efficiency of 16.3% photons/electron (~41 cd/A) was achieved with a good color rendering index (CRI) of 76, and a Commission Internationale de l'eclairage (CIE) coordinate of (x = 0.38, y = 0.46). At brightness of 100 and 500 cd/m~2, the external quantum efficiencies reached 11% and W%, respectively. The performance of the WOLED is better than that fabricated by co-evaporation method due to an improved exciton capture and emission efficiencies. This work presents an alternative way of fabricating WOLED.
